Fishery overview

The Chena near Two Rivers is the upper Chena fishing reach along Chena Hot Springs Road. StrikeTracks publishes Monitoring-Backed conditions from USGS 15493000 (live discharge, stage, and water temperature). Distinct from the Fairbanks urban Chena 15514000, which has no live 00010 and is not this ID. Arctic grayling are the classic Interior fly target and are described in text only. Resident rainbow trout are the honest selector primary. Chinook are present as a seasonal ADF&G fishery, not a run-count rating. Flow Context remains default-deny. Access and Public Fishing Rights

Public fishing is documented by ADF&G Fairbanks Area sport-fishing pages and Chena River State Recreation Area access. Catalog coordinates are the USGS point, not a launch pin. Private land occurs; use posted public access.

Stocking information

ADF&G Interior manages the Chena as a wild grayling fishery with salmon seasons. Confirm current official stocking separately. Do not invent a stocking calendar.
